1. 程式人生 > >bat中呼叫另外一個bat

bat中呼叫另外一個bat

::檔名:callbat.bat

::檔案路徑:E:\dldl_s_svn\game\build

::功能:進入C盤,將proto生成php,然後將生成的php檔案拷貝到E盤的某個目錄

::將本目錄下的proto檔案拷貝到C盤的編譯目錄下
copy .\CProtoData.proto C:\Cygwin\home\www\game\build

::分割槽切換,從當前分割槽切換到C磁碟分割槽
C:

::進入proto檔案所在的目錄
cd Cygwin\home\www\game\build

:: 呼叫編譯命令
call build.bat

echo "finish build proto-php"

::拷貝編譯好的檔案到目的路徑1,假如目的路徑為 E:\dldl_s_svn\game\build
copy C:\Cygwin\home\www\game\build\pb_proto_CProtoData.php E:\dldl_s_svn\game\build\

::拷貝編譯好的檔案到目的路徑2,假如目的路徑為 E:\dldl_s_svn\game\application\config\proto
copy C:\Cygwin\home\www\game\build\pb_proto_CProtoData.php E:\dldl_s_svn\game\application\config\proto

echo "finish copy php file to target directory"

pause

:: 檔案到此結束

功能:進入C盤 ---> 進入C盤下的Cygwin-home-www-game-build目錄 ---> 執行該目錄下的build.bat指令碼,將proto檔案生成php檔案 ---> 將php檔案拷貝到E盤的某個目錄

相關推薦

bat呼叫另外一個bat

::檔名:callbat.bat ::檔案路徑:E:\dldl_s_svn\game\build ::功能:進入C盤,將proto生成php,然後將生成的php檔案拷貝到E盤的某個目錄 ::將本目錄下的proto檔案拷貝到C盤的編譯目錄下 copy .\CProtoDat

如何在一個bat批處理檔案呼叫一個bat批處理檔案?

我們有兩個批處理檔案outter和批處理檔案inner,其內容如下: outter.bat [plain] view plain copy  print? echo "start to call inner bat here"   inner.bat     

在jsp頁面呼叫另外一個jap頁面

(1)include指令          include指令告訴容器:複製被包含檔案彙總的所有內容,再把它貼上到這個檔案中。 <%@ include file="Header.jsp"%> (2)include標準動作 <jsp:include

Shell指令碼呼叫另外一個指令碼的方法

       在Linux平臺上開發,經常會在console(控制檯)上執行另外一個指令碼檔案,經常用的方法有:./my.sh 或 source my.sh 或 . my.sh;這三種方法有什麼不同呢?我們先來了解一下在一個shell指令碼中如何呼叫另外一個shell指令

Python3-模組呼叫示例(從一個資料夾呼叫另外一個資料夾的類)

1、資料夾的佈局 2、呼叫流程 modal中的 new_cound.py 繼承modal中count中A類 test資料夾中counttest.py呼叫new_cound中的B類 程式碼如下:count.py class A(): def _

在同一個解決方案下,如何從一個工程呼叫另外一個工程的函式

  兩個專案分別是test1和test2,test1中有一個函式fun()被test2呼叫,用法如下: //test1.h int fun(int a, int b); //test1.cpp #include <iostream> #include "

windows呼叫另外一個EXE程式,WinExec+Cmd+BAT

首先說一下:WinExec的函式原型: UINT Win Exec(LPCSTR lpCmdLine, UINT uCmdShow); 引數:lpCmdLine:指向一個空結束的字串,串中包含將要執

vuemethods一個方法呼叫另外一個方法

vue在同一個元件內; methods中的一個方法呼叫methods中的另外一個方法 可以在呼叫的時候 this.$options.methods.test2(); this.$options.methods.test2();一個方法呼叫另外一個方法; new Vue({

在同一個類一個方法呼叫另外一個有註解(比如@Async,@Transational)的方法,註解失效的原因和解決方法

在同一個類中,一個方法呼叫另外一個有註解(比如@Async,@Transational)的方法,註解是不會生效的。 比如,下面程式碼例子中,有兩方法,一個有@Transational註解,一個沒有。如果呼叫了有註解的addPerson()方法,會啟動一個Transaction;如果呼叫updatePerso

VS CodeC檔案呼叫另外一個C檔案

main.c #include <stdio.h> #include "BaseStore.h" int main() { baseStore_aboutSizeofFunc(); return 0; } BaseStore.h #includ

C#反射呼叫另外一個的私有欄位和方法

        /// <summary>        /// 設計器支援所需的方法 - 不要        /// 使用程式碼編輯器修改此方法的內容。        /// </summary>        private void InitializeComponent()  

asp.net使用者自定義控制元件呼叫另外一個使用者自定義控制元件的方法

昨天同事問我一個問題,說是在一個頁面中有二個使用者自定義控制元件,他現在想在其中一個使用者自定義控制元件中呼叫另外一個使用者自定義控制元件的一個方法。當時感覺很奇怪,為什麼要這樣呢。可是他說他要完成這樣一個功能,所以我就簡單的用一個反射的功能來完成它。試了一下,還行功能可以實

spring 本類方法呼叫另外一個方法事務不生效

1、在spring配置檔案中新增 <aop:aspectj-autoproxy expose-proxy="true"/&g

在python程式呼叫一個py檔案

在同一個資料夾下 呼叫函式: A.py檔案:     def add(x,y): print('和為:%d'%(x+y)) B.py檔案:     import A A.add

python檔案呼叫一個python檔案的類

如果是在同一個 module中(也就是同一個py 檔案裡),直接用就可以 如果在不同的module裡,例如 a.py裡有 class A: b.py 裡有 class B: 如果你要在class B裡用class A 需要在 b.py的開頭寫上 from a import A  

安卓的資料共享——從一個APP呼叫一個APP資料的方法

在Android中如何在一個APP中呼叫另一個APP中的資料呢?大致有以下五種方法可以實現 1、首選項資訊-Shared Preferences 2、檔案 3、SQLite 4、Content Provider 5、廣播 下來對上述的五種方法進行詳細的解析: 1、首先對

iframe獲取父視窗的父視窗另外一個iframe的元素問題

頁面層次結構如下: ————- mainPage(mainPage有兩個iframe:iframe1和iframe2) ————————iframe1 ————————iframe2(iframe2中又巢狀一個iframe:iframe2_1) ———————————–i

python在一個字串找到另外一個字串並找到該字元起始的位置

程式碼詳解 def index_of_str(seq, sub_seq): index=[] n1=len(seq) n2=len(sub_seq) for i i

如何使用spring容器在一個呼叫一個類的方法。

學了spring容器之後,最基本的就是這個在一個類中呼叫另一個類中的方法了。本文講述的就是如何使用spring容器從一個類呼叫另一個類的方法。首先,我們先新建一個Student類,在類中建立一個int型別的方法。如圖: 第一個類Student就完成了,那麼我們

python 在一個py檔案呼叫一個資料夾下py檔案模組

假設現在的資料夾結構如下: -- src     |-- dir1     |    -- file1.py     |-- dir2     |